Pickleball was invented in 1965 by Congressman and successful businessman Joel Pritchard. Only in recent years has it caught on across the nation and now Macon is making its name for itself in the world of the tennis-like sport.
Macon is the home to the world's biggest pickleball venue now that the Rhythm & Rally Sports & Events venue has opened, according to the venue.
Rhythm & Rally Sports & Events is a 150,000 square feet facility that features 32 indoor courts, 16 upstairs and 16 downstairs, with amenities like lockers, showers, and a Pro-Shop to help pickleball players improve their skills.
The sports venue will offer multiple levels of membership including a Family Platinum Membership for $100 a month, an Individual Platinum Membership for $75 a month, a $75 a month Family Gold Membership, and a $40 a month Individual Gold Membership.
Rhythm and Rally Sports and Events is located in the Macon Mall on Eisenhower Parkway and will be open from 10 a.m. until 6 p.m.
